For the Petitioner/s : Mr. Manoj Kumar, Adv. For the Opposite Party/s : Mr. M.K. Nirala, APP ====================================================== CORAM: HONOURABLE MR. JUSTICE SHIVAJI PANDEY ORAL ORDER 31-01-2018 Heard learned counsel for the petitioners and learned counsel for the State.
In this case, the petitioners are apprehending their arrest in connection with Makhdumpur P.S. Case No. 112 of 2017 registered for offences under sections 147, 148, 149, 341, 323, 307, 379, 504, 506 of the Indian Penal Code.
Already this Court, vide earlier order dated 19.9.2017, has rejected the prayer for anticipatory bail of the petitioner nos. 2, 4 & 5 respectively and, thus, the present application is confined to the petitioner nos. 1 & 3 only. Learned counsel for the petitioners has produced the
Patna High Court Cr.Misc. No.40669 of 2017 (4) dt.31-01-2018 certified copy of the First Information Report from which it appears that the petitioners have not named as an accused persons. The allegation against the petitioner nos. 1 & 3 is with respect to Section 498A and 3/4 of the Dowry Prohibition Act and there is no specific allegation against them Looking to the entire facts and circumstances of the case, let the petitioner nos. 1 & 3, namely, Md. Sonu and Md. Soeb Ahmad @ Guddu, in the event of their arrest or surrender before the court below within a period of four weeks from today, be released on bail on furnishing bail bond of Rs. 10,000/- (ten thousand) each with two sureties of the like amount each to the satisfaction of S.D.J.M., Jehanabad in connection with Makhadumpur P.S. Case No. 112 of 2017, subject to the conditions as laid down under Section 438(2) of the Cr.P.C. (Shivaji Pandey, J) Rishi/- U T
